Department of Arts, Heritage and the Gaeltacht
Departmental Social Media Monitoring

333. To ask the Minister for Arts, Heritage and the Gaeltacht if his Department currently engages in real-time reporting of online conversations on issues relating to his Department;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[6592/14]

While my Department is fully committed to making information relating to its activities available online, it does not currently engage in the practice referred to in the Deputy's Question. The Press Office of my Department will shortly be setting up a Twitter account for my Department, which is expected to cover some or all of the following: press releases on my Department’s activities and Ministerial speeches; event information; alerts about new content on my Department's website; and other practical information on services available through my Department.
However, if the Deputy has any specific queries as to how he might find information on a matter relating to my Department, I would be glad to seek to assist him in that regard.
